Human Rights Initiative at the University at Buffalo

Medical director Kim Griswold, MD (center), works with care coordinators — including Ali Kadhum (left) and Anna Skop — and medical students to address refugees’ needs.

As part of a community coalition, this medical student-run asylum clinic collaborates with licensed healthcare professionals in to provide forensic evaluations for survivors of torture seeking asylum in the United States.

The Human Rights Initiative at the University at Buffalo (formerly the WNY Human Rights Clinic) was founded in 2014 to serve the need for medical and psychiatric forensic evaluations of survivors of torture seeking asylum status in the Buffalo area.
